1. What is the Angle Between Diagonal and Length of Rectangle?

The angle between the diagonal and length of a rectangle is the acute angle formed between the diagonal and the longer side (length) of the rectangle. This angle helps in understanding the geometric properties and proportions of the rectangle.

2. How Does the Calculator Work?

The calculator uses the formula:

\[ \angle dl = \arctan\left(\frac{b}{\left(\frac{P}{2}\right) - b}\right) \]

Where:

Explanation: The formula derives from the relationship between the sides of the rectangle and its perimeter, using trigonometric functions to calculate the angle.

5.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q1: What is the range of possible angles?
A: The angle ranges from 0° to 45°, where 0° occurs when breadth approaches 0, and 45° occurs when the rectangle becomes a square.

Q2: Can this calculator handle different units?
A: The calculator uses meters as the default unit, but you can use any consistent unit system as long as both inputs use the same units.

Q3: What if the perimeter is less than twice the breadth?
A: This would violate the definition of a rectangle (where length > breadth), so the calculator requires P > 2b.
